Episode 34 - High Seismic

The podcast discusses high seismic design questions, including working with architects and design codes. They explore impressive construction of a building in 10 days using modular units. They also discuss efficient thermal envelopes with poly isocyanurate foam, high seismic regions in the US, choosing a seismic system, lateral force resolving systems, analyzing seismic design, and irregularities in structures impacting stability.
